Today's Redding Record Searchlight has an article telling about the eastern Shasta County windmill project near Burney, CA. The article is a little vague on how the various components will be transported to Shasta County, but it does mention some parts arriving in Stockton (Port of Stockton I presume) from Europe. Additionally it is mentioned that as many as 350 trucks will be needed to haul components to site east of Redding.
The article also mentions trains from the Midwest hauling some of the components.
Would the UP windmill trains go directly to the Redding area, such as a nearby siding or the Shasta Cascade Forest Industries Transload facility, or to a different location, such as Stockton?
